This exceptional three-story commercial building at 207 E Edgar Street in Seattle, WA, presents a rare opportunity for owner-occupancy or redevelopment. Situated on a 0.13-acre lot (5,500 square feet), this 4,660 square foot building is offered for sale at $1,800,000. Currently vacant, the property offers immediate usability for a wide range of commercial ventures. The building's prime location in the desirable Eastlake neighborhood provides breathtaking views of Lake Union, Gas Works Park, and the Olympic Mountains. Its NC2-65(M2) zoning designation unlocks significant development potential. According to the zoning, the site could potentially accommodate the construction of up to five townhouses
